When using Scientific Notation, there are
two kinds of exponents: positive and
negative
Positive Exponent:
2.35 x 108

Negative Exponent:
3.97 x 10-7
When changing scientific notation to
standard notation, the exponent tells you
if you should move the decimal:

With a positive exponent, move the


decimal to the right:
4.08 x 103 = 4 0 8

Don’t forget to fill in your zeroes!


When changing scientific notation to
standard notation, the exponent tells you
if you should move the decimal:

With a negative exponent, move the


decimal to the left:
4.08 x 10-3 = 408

Don’t forget to fill in your zeroes!


An easy way to remember this is:
• If an exponent is positive, the number
gets larger, so move the decimal to
the right.

• If an exponent is negative, the


number gets smaller, so move the
decimal to the left.
The exponent also tells how many spaces
to move the decimal:

4.08 x 103 = 4 0 8

In this problem, the exponent is +3, so


the decimal moves 3 spaces to the right.
The exponent also tells how many spaces
to move the decimal:

4.08 x 10-3 = 408

In this problem, the exponent is -3, so the


decimal moves 3 spaces to the left.

When changing from Standard Notation
to Scientific Notation:
1) First, move the decimal after the first whole
number:
3258
2) Second, add your multiplication sign and
your base (10).
3 . 2 5 8 x 10
3) Count how many spaces the decimal moved
and this is the exponent.
3 . 2 5 8 x 10 3
3 2 1
When changing from Standard Notation
to Scientific Notation:
4) See if the original number is greater than or
less than one.
– If the number is greater than one, the
exponent will be positive.
348943 = 3.489 x 105

– If the number is less than one, the


exponent will be negative.
.0000000672 = 6.72 x 10-8
